Coolite
A lightweight Fabric client-side mod that displays item cooldowns as a HUD overlay.
Designed for servers using custom cooldown systems via the Apollo protocol.
Features
- Cooldown HUD — Shows active item cooldowns with a progress bar and remaining time
- Custom Model Data support — Renders the correct custom item texture when a CMD is assigned
- Configurable position & scale — Place the HUD anywhere on screen
- Left / Right layout — Choose whether the HUD grows to the right or to the left

Config options
| Option | Description |
|---|---|
| X / Y | HUD position as a 0–1000 screen ratio |
| Scale | HUD size multiplier (0.1–10.0) |
| L / R | Direction the HUD expands toward |
Note: The default HUD position may not suit your screen resolution or GUI scale.
It is strongly recommended to open the config screen and adjust the position and scale to fit your setup before playing.
The config screen shows a live preview so you can fine-tune it in real time.
Requirements
- Minecraft 1.21.x
- Fabric Loader
- Fabric API
- Mod Menu (optional — for in-game config access)
Notes
This mod is intended for use on specific servers that send cooldown data via the Apollo protocol.
It will not display anything on servers that do not support this.
